Quote:
Originally Posted by West E View Post
doesn't Kroenke own the Rams and the Nuggets?
Kroenke had to transfer ownership of the Nuggets and Avalanche to his son when he became the Rams majority owner. In reality Kroenke probably still runs all the teams and the NFL could have told him that if he wanted to own the Rams he'd have to sell the other teams, but the NFL wanted Kroenke (and his Wal-Mart heir wife) as owners so they didn't object to the transfer of ownership. I don't think they'd make the same concessions if Cuban tried to buy an NFL team and offer to have it (or the Mavs) in his wife's name.

It's been long known that the team would be sold once Wilson passed away so it'll be interesting to see who buys the Bills. They've got a lease with Buffalo through 2023, although they can buy their way out of the lease following the 2020 season for $28.4 million, so it's not a case where the new owner could buy the team and then immediately try and move the team to LA.
